Biography

Abraham Auerbach has Jewish Roots.
Abraham Auerbach has German Roots.

Abraham Auerbach was born in Germany, 1 Aug 1835. He was the son of Emanuel "Mendel" Auerbach[1] OR (more likely) Mendel's cousin, Heinrich Auerbach, and Marianna Vierfelder[2]. He could not have been the son of Mendel's wife, Ernestine Frank, unless one of their birth years is incorrect.

Abraham immigrated to the USA with his wife, son, and his wife's family, arriving New York City, New York, United States, 1867[3], and was naturalized on 17 Oct 1874, New York, New York, United States.[4]

Abraham lived in Iowa.

  • 1870: Abraham Auerbacher, Davenport, Scott, Iowa, United States.[2]
  • c. 1871: Abram Auerbach, 36 years old, Military Service, Davenport, Scott, Iowa, United States.[5]

39-year-old Abraham Auerbacher passed away in Davenport, Scott, Iowa, United States, 30 Dec 1874, 2 months after he became a naturalized US citizen and was buried in Mount Nebo Hebrew Cemetery, Davenport, Scott County, Iowa, USA.

  • Abraham Auerbacher (1835–1874), Mount Nebo Hebrew Cemetery, Davenport, Scott County, Iowa, USA.[6]
